Jaunty 64-bit host, Windows 7 32-bit guest
When in the file manager in the Windows guest, if I select and right click to copy a file, when I go to try and paste the file, the paste options are greyed out. Similarly Ctrl-C --> Ctrl-V also doesn't work.
Inside some applications, like OrCAD Capture, copy/paste is not working correctly (at all).
Reverting to VirtualBox V2.2.4 solves the problem.

Turning off the shared clipboard seems to solve the problem.
